**Artifact Signing — sqlcheck rule packs**

The linting rules for SQL files (naming conventions, forbidden full-table scans, migration-safety checks) are distributed as versioned rule packs from the Slatequery build system. On-call: if the linter refuses to load a pack, it's almost always a signature mismatch after a rotation, not a corrupt download. Re-fetch the pack and re-verify before escalating. Packs are rejected outright if unsigned, so never hand-edit a pack on a host. All current rule packs are verified against the key below.

deploy key for kajof-fajop: bky6_gDHw9Q

## Who to ping about GiftNote

Welcome aboard! GiftNote is our donation-receipt mailer for the Larchfield Fund. Template tweaks go to the comms folks; delivery failures and bounce weirdness go to the platform crew. Don't push template changes on Fridays — receipts batch over the weekend. For anything GiftNote-related, start with the address below.

billing contact of kaweg-tajeg = drudor.lamion.oliath@torvalabs.test

Subject: New owner for the order-cutoff rule

Hi plugin authors! Quick note about the Crumbline bakery platform. The order-cutoff rule — the logic that decides when same-day orders close per storefront — is getting a new owner as part of our team reshuffle. If your plugin hooks into cutoff events or overrides the default 2 p.m. window, expect a short compatibility review in the next release cycle. Nothing breaks today, promise. Questions about cutoff behavior, edge cases, or the new extension points should now go to the following person.

named custodian: Belius Casath Ulaix Sorius